About Orange

Orange is a British brand founded in 1968 in London by musician and electronics designer Cliff Cooper. It began as a small music shop and recording-studio venture before Cooper and collaborators started building their own amplifiers, giving the company its early identity and its now-famous orange styling.

Orange is best known for guitar and bass amplifiers, plus speaker cabinets and combo amps. In recent years, the brand has broadened beyond pro-guitar gear into hi-fi products such as turntables, headphones, portable Bluetooth speakers, and compact home audio systems, though amplification remains its core association.

In the market, Orange sits as a mid-to-upper-tier specialty brand with a strong vintage-inspired identity rather than a luxury hi-fi house. Its reputation is strongest among musicians and guitarists, where it is a classic, highly recognizable name; in consumer audio, it is more of a niche crossover brand than a mainstream hi-fi heavyweight.
